In response, our research presents a novel framework known as the Hierarchical Interactive Uncertainty-aware Network (HIUNet). HIUNet leverages Bayesian neural networks for the extraction of robust shallow features, bolstered by pre-trained encoders for feature extraction and the agility of lightweight decoders for preliminary image reconstitution. Subsequently, a feature frequency selection mechanism is activated to enhance overall performance by strategically identifying and retaining valuable features while effectively suppressing redundant and irrelevant ones. Following this, a feature enhancement module is applied to the preliminary restoration. This intricate fusion culminates in the production of a restored image of superior quality. Our extensive experiments, using our proposed Sand11K dataset that exhibits various levels of degradation from dust and sand, confirm the effectiveness and soundness of our proposed method. By modeling uncertainty via Bayesian neural networks to extract robust shallow features and selecting valuable features through frequency selection, HIUNet can reconstruct high-quality clean images.
